VisualStudio.NET:可视化建模提升协作与生产力

0 下载量 157 浏览量 更新于2024-07-14 收藏 155KB PDF 举报
"本文主要介绍了可视化模型软件应用程序在构建复杂分布式应用程序中的重要性,特别是针对XMLWeb服务的挑战。Visual Studio .NET提供了一系列的可视化工具,包括Visio图表和UML(统一建模语言)标准,来促进团队协作和提高生产力。通过创建详细的图表,可以清晰地描述应用程序的架构和需求,从而改善团队间的沟通。文中还通过汽车租赁软件系统的例子,展示了如何使用8种UML图表类型来模型化系统,并特别提到了使用事件表、静态结构(类)图表等来展示系统交互和结构。" 可视化模型软件应用程序是应对复杂分布式应用开发中跨团队协作挑战的有效工具。在处理结构松散的XMLWeb服务时,这种工具尤为重要,因为它们能帮助团队成员更快速、准确地理解项目信息。Visual Studio .NET是这样一款强大的软件,它提供了一系列的可视化模型工具,涵盖了从自由图表到工业标准的UML图表,帮助开发者描述和解释软件应用程序的组件、关系和活动。 UML是一种标准化的建模语言,能够详细描绘出软件应用程序的各个方面。在Visual Studio .NET中,用户可以利用这些工具创建复杂的图表,以展示应用程序的结构和业务需求,促进团队内部的沟通。这不仅适用于开发者,也适用于企业分析师、架构师等参与分析和设计的人员,提升团队的整体生产力。 以汽车租赁软件系统为例,我们可以看到如何利用不同的UML图表类型来模型化系统。使用事件表揭示了用户与系统的交互,例如客户预约、获取和返还汽车的过程。静态结构(类)图表则用于分类系统中的对象及其关系,通过识别使用事件来确定需要的类别,展示系统的整体结构、关系以及对象的行为属性。 此外,还有其他类型的UML图表,如序列图、协作图、状态图、活动图等,它们分别用于描述对象之间的交互顺序、对象之间的协作方式、对象状态的转换以及系统的动态行为。通过综合运用这些图表,开发者能够更全面地理解并设计出满足需求的软件系统。 可视化模型软件应用程序,特别是Visual Studio .NET,为构建和理解复杂软件系统提供了有力的支持。通过使用UML和其他可视化工具,团队成员可以更好地协同工作,提高软件开发的效率和质量。
手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部